--- jsr166/src/test/tck/ArrayDequeTest.java 2016/11/06 15:59:52 1.54 +++ jsr166/src/test/tck/ArrayDequeTest.java 2019/12/16 21:16:09 1.58 @@ -8,7 +8,6 @@ import java.util.ArrayDeque; import java.util.Arrays; import java.util.Collection; -import java.util.Collections; import java.util.Deque; import java.util.Iterator; import java.util.NoSuchElementException; @@ -17,7 +16,6 @@ import java.util.Random; import java.util.concurrent.ThreadLocalRandom; import junit.framework.Test; -import junit.framework.TestSuite; public class ArrayDequeTest extends JSR166TestCase { public static void main(String[] args) { @@ -713,7 +711,7 @@ public class ArrayDequeTest extends JSR1 Integer x = (Integer) it.next(); assertEquals(s + i, (int) x); for (Object[] a : as) - assertSame(a1[i], x); + assertSame(a[i], x); } } @@ -747,7 +745,7 @@ public class ArrayDequeTest extends JSR1 ArrayDeque l = new ArrayDeque(); l.add(new Object()); try { - l.toArray(null); + l.toArray((Object[])null); shouldThrow(); } catch (NullPointerException success) {} } @@ -914,7 +912,7 @@ public class ArrayDequeTest extends JSR1 } /** - * A deserialized serialized deque has same elements in same order + * A deserialized/reserialized deque has same elements in same order */ public void testSerialization() throws Exception { Queue x = populatedDeque(SIZE);